i agree that there are other culprits (eg diesel fuel, engine oil additives added to what is already packed in the oil, fuel additives) to consider in the sludge build up on a diesel engine. in order to come up with a conclusive finding one can only engage in the process of elimination by doing away with some items not necessary in the combustion process such as the utilization of additives. that leaves the essentials only like the fuel & engine oil, by using a cleaner fuel like a euro4 type will help isolate the problem whether its the engine oil or not
in all these the original proposition of collecting used oil sample after an oil change & checking what you find in it afterwards still stand
